Dubai: SkyDive Dubai and Warsan 11 eased their way into the next stage of the volleyball competition at the Nad Al Sheba (NAS) Ramadan Championships being held at the NAS Club.

SkyDive Dubai did well to earn a 25-20, 23-25, 25-21, 25-20 win over Shaikh Hamdan Office, while Warsan 11 had powered their way to a 25-12, 25-13, 25-16 victory over Studio Zabeel to set up a meeting against each other in the knockout stages of the competition late on Saturday.

Held under the patronage of Shaikh Hamdan Bin Mohammad Bin Rashid Al Maktoum, Crown Prince of Dubai and Chairman of Dubai Sports Council (DSC), the annual event has a total prize offering of Dh 7 million for winners in all activities.

The volleyball tournament got under way last Thursday along with Padel Tennis competition that has attracted some of the top players in the world. The five-a-side futsal tournament involving 20 teams is scheduled to start from July 18.

Besides the regular competitions, there are one-off competitions that are being organised, including a 70km cycle race (July 26), an exhibition football match most likely involving Dubai sports ambassador Diego Maradona and former Real Madrid defender Michel Salgado (July 19) and a 10km race that was held last Friday with a total prize fund of Dh850,000 for each of these activities.
